J.V. Boys Volleyball Experiences Success On and Off the Court

   by Ryan Eshoff

The J.V. boys volleyball closed down their season in impressive fashion, finishing in the middle of the pack in the WCAL.

A team that was consistently one of the smallest in the league overcame the size discrepancy with tremendous displays of heart and focus.

Bouncing back from a defeat against the undefeated Lancers of St. Francis, the Warriors found themselves locked in a fierce confrontation with the Irish of Sacred Heart Cathedral. The luck of the Irish was the slightest difference in the end, as Sacred Heart pulled out a three-set victory, 25-21, 23-25, 15-12.

                  Concluding their season with a two-game week, VC hoped to at least gain a split. Against the St. Ignatius Wildcats, the Warriors earned a two-set victory 26-24, 25-22. Unfortunately, their year came to a close with a 21-25, 25-18, 15-7 defeat at the hands of Junipero Serra, However, the guys did not let this season-ending loss dampen their spirits over a fine 4-8 season in the WCAL.
